General specs
- Brand: LED Flying Direct
- Model: LF-SB300W-HV
- Seller: Amazon
- Wattage: 300 watts
- Luminous Flux: 42000 Lumen
- Color Temperature: 5000K
- Input Voltage: 100-277V
- IP Rating: IP65
- Mounting Type: Slip fitter for round pole
- Material: Aluminum
- Dimensions: 26"L x 13"W x 2.5"H
- Weight: 17.41 pounds
- Warranty: 5-year
